The rural town of Santiago Matatlàn, just to the east of Oaxaca City in the Valles Centrales region, is widely known as the epicenter for traditional mezcal production. Many small villages in Oaxaca are known for an art, craft, or trade that artisans in the village specialize in. In Santiago Matatlàn, it is mezcal they are known and celebrated for, and have been for generations. The Espadàân agave harvested by the Cortàs family to produce this expression of Nuestra Soledad grows at an elevation of 5,500-5,900 feet in a mountain canyon rich with agave diversity. Amongst stunning vistas, the Espadàân agaves for this mezcal are sustainably cultivated alongside wild outcrops of Tepeztate, Tobalà and Coyote agaves. Mezcalero Gregorio Martinez Jarquàân has been working in Santiago Matatlàn since he was a teenager and is widely respected in the mezcalero community.
